This is a time-lapse video of an average day of flatbedding for me. I am an independent owner operator. The video starts in Kansas and ends in Oklahoma City. This video was one of my first uploads but I got a copyright claim so I had to edit it an re-upload it. Enjoy. 😉 😉 😉
